Number of roles opened and closed for Security Engineers in Geneva in the last 3 months

Number of roles opened and closed for Security Engineers in Geneva in the last 3 months

Over the past 12 weeks, the Security Engineers job market in Switzerland Geneva has shown considerable fluctuations. Notably, the number of new job postings peaked at 17 in week 21, while a significant downturn to only 1 posting occurred in week 22. Throughout this period, the number of jobs closed also varied, with a peak of 15 closures in week 25, indicating a competitive landscape for Security Engineer roles. Seniority distribution of Security Engineer job openings in Geneva

Seniority Distribution of Security Engineering Jobs in Geneva

In the Security Engineers job market trends in Switzerland Geneva, the seniority distribution reveals that 48% of available positions are for Mid-Senior level professionals, followed by 27% for Associates and 6% for Entry level roles. Chart about preferred employment type for Engineering roles in Switzerland

Preferred employment type for Engineering roles in Switzerland

The employment type distribution for engineering roles in Switzerland reflects a strong preference for full-time positions, which constitute 92% of the market. Part-time roles account for 8%, while contract positions make up 6%. Time to Hire Distribution for Security in Switzerland

How long does it take to hire Security Engineers

The time to hire distribution for Security Engineers in Switzerland reveals significant insights into the recruitment landscape in Geneva. The data indicates a substantial number of roles are filled within a timeframe of 30 to 40 days, with 264 placements taking place at the 30-day mark and 66 at 40 days. This demonstrates a competitive job market for Security roles, suggesting that hiring managers and CTOs must be proactive in their recruitment strategies. Notably, the 10-day benchmark shows a strong count of 159, indicating a potential opportunity for quicker placements. Most popular cities in Switzerland to hire Security Engineers

Top 5 cities in Switzerland to hire Security Engineers

In Switzerland, the distribution of job openings for Security Engineers highlights Zurich as the leading city, accounting for 61% of the total opportunities. Geneva follows with 19%, while Bern contributes 18% to the job market. Most sought after technologies in Geneva for Security

Key technologies for Security Engineers

In the Security Engineers job market in Switzerland, particularly in Geneva, several technologies are prevalent. The most utilized technology is Cybersecurity, with a frequency of 7,813, highlighting its critical role in the security landscape. Following closely is Risk Management, utilized 4,123 times, underscoring the importance of identifying and mitigating risks. Compliance, with 4,071 mentions, further emphasizes the regulatory aspects of security roles. Additionally, Incident Response is frequently highlighted with 3,499 occurrences, reflecting the need for preparedness against security breaches.
